Filtration System Installation in Houston, TX

Filtration system installation services involve setting up specialized systems designed to improve indoor air and water quality for residential properties. These installations can include air purifiers, water filters, and whole-house filtration units that help remove contaminants, allergens, and impurities. Homeowners often seek this service to ensure healthier living environments, especially in areas with concerns about air quality or water safety. Projects may range from upgrading existing filtration units to installing entirely new systems tailored to the specific needs of a property.

Property owners considering filtration system installation should understand the different types of systems available and their suitability for their home. Factors such as the size of the property, the primary concern (airborne particles versus water impurities), and maintenance requirements are important to evaluate before requesting service. Consulting with a professional can help determine the most effective solution, ensuring the system integrates properly with the existing infrastructure and meets the household’s health and comfort priorities.

Filtration System Installation Questions

What types of filtration systems are available for installation? There are various options including whole-house filters, sediment filters, and specialty systems designed to improve water quality based on specific needs.

How do I know if a filtration system is right for my property? Property owners should consider water quality concerns, such as sediment, chlorine, or odors, to determine if a filtration system can address those issues effectively.

What should be considered before installing a filtration system? Factors include the size of the property, water usage, and the specific contaminants present in the water supply.

Can a filtration system be integrated with existing plumbing? Yes, most filtration systems are designed to connect seamlessly with existing plumbing setups for efficient operation.
